Transaction 4137f225f83afd915c931a29d44643e466238610bae3d3dc77a074989361bb98

1 Input
2 Outputs
  • 4137f225f83afd915c931a29d44643e466238610bae3d3dc77a074989361bb98:0
  • value  395222115
    address  1PkTKyfUWT89rfTJPBdz54ugxAYwARjYLM
  • 4137f225f83afd915c931a29d44643e466238610bae3d3dc77a074989361bb98:1
  • value  27768834
    address  3KQfodfgFVg8Viouj3KTAdDhPPGPVdbxmK